Understanding the AI-Powered UI Builder Ecosystem
At its core, an AI-powered UI builder uses machine learning models, natural language processing, and computer vision to generate and optimize design components automatically. It interprets textual prompts, design briefs, or even existing wireframes to build responsive UI elements without the traditional coding overhead. Platforms like Uizard, Relume, and Galileo AI exemplify this trend, where adaptive AI interprets intent and instantly transforms it into high-quality design output.

Top AI-Powered UI Builder Platforms
| Platform Name | Key Advantages | Ratings | Ideal Use Case |
|---|---|---|---|
| Uizard | Converts text or sketches to digital prototypes instantly | 9.3/10 | Rapid prototyping and startup MVPs |
| Relume | Integrates with Figma and Webflow for cohesive workflows | 9.1/10 | Web design teams scaling production |
| Galileo AI | Generates UI components using natural language | 9.0/10 | Product teams needing adaptive interfaces |
| Fronty | Converts static images to HTML/CSS code using AI | 8.9/10 | Developers modernizing legacy designs |
Each of these tools demonstrates how generative intelligence blends creativity with precision. Their evolution points toward a new category of “design co-pilots” that learn from usage patterns, improving intuitiveness and usability over time.

Core Technology Behind AI UI Builders
AI-powered UI builders use a combination of neural rendering algorithms, reinforcement learning, and component recognition. They analyze large datasets of existing application UIs to learn structural patterns between typography, color, and spacing rules. This contextual understanding allows AI to generate layouts aligned with modern design systems like Material Design and Apple’s Human Interface Guidelines.
Generative models, especially transformer-based architectures, can read a textual prompt like “Create a mobile dashboard for a fitness tracking app with dark mode” and instantly produce a responsive layout. Adaptive fine-tuning ensures that generated designs obey branding color schemes, data hierarchy, and usability benchmarks.

Common Questions About AI UI Builders
What does an AI-powered UI builder do?
It automates UI design generation using artificial intelligence to convert natural language, wireframes, or sketches into production-ready digital interfaces.
Who benefits from using AI UI builders?
Designers, developers, startups, agencies, and enterprises all benefit by saving time, minimizing manual coding, and improving brand consistency.
Can AI-generated UIs maintain design quality?
Yes. With reinforcement learning and dataset refinement, these tools now produce on-brand, accessible, and responsive designs compatible with multiple frameworks.
